Finishing Error: a b 1 *Ignore 2 Display Error Finishing Error (Setting when a finishing error occurs) Select the setting when finishing (stapling, punching, sorting, or auto image rotation) is not possible for the selected paper size or type. Display • A message is displayed and printing stops. Error Ignore • A message is not displayed and printing continues without finishing. 1 In the Error Handling menu, press U or V to select Finishing Error. 2 Press [OK]. The Finishing Error screen appears. No Staple Error: a b 1 *Ignore 2 Display Error 3 Press U or V to select the setting for handling finishing error. 4 Press [OK]. The handling of finishing error is set and the Error Handling menu screen reappears. No Staple Error (Setting when the staples run out) This setting can be specified when an optional document finisher is installed. Select the setting when the staples run out and the Add staples. message is displayed during stapling. Display • A message is displayed and printing stops. Printing Error automatically resumes when staples are added. Ignore • A message is displayed, however, printing continues without stapling. 1 In the Error Handling menu, press U or V to select No Staple Error. 2 Press [OK]. The No Staple Error screen appears. 3 Press U or V to select the setting for handling no staple error. 4 Press [OK]. The handling of no staple error is set and the Error Handling menu screen reappears. 4-78 Using the Operation Panel
